This is the new (old) canoe that I purchased. Oscodo 17 foot fiberglass canoe from 1986...I through a 40lb thrust trolling motor on it for fun as well...I have to say, I'm used to my yak so being in this thing, sitting down...is a little tough. It's a little unstable at first, but once you figure out the balance it's not too bad. Casting is a bit of a challenge sitting down as well, but it's manageable. Now...I've never really had a boat with a motor, especially a canoe. We had a few close call tip overs...but we managed in the end to not get wet. My buddy Dustin and I motored all over this lake and had a blast.

One of the things that I enjoy the most about fly fishing is the wildlife. These little turtles were everywhere basking in the sun today...probably making up for the cloud and rain filled post winter we've been having...




My first couple of Smallmouth were hooked up with my Fleeing Bucktail fly...It's my take on a Half and Half...This one was tied in yellow...They were smashing it...





A few of my catches for the day...We got into Smallies, some Largemouth, Bluegills, Crappie and Rock Bass....My Flashback Damsel Fly Nymph was a killer today....Fish after fish, every species ate it today....
